Project Engineer
Project Engineer working on package areas of the Triumph Rocket 3, Trophy and Thunderbird models. Responsible for all Engineering activity on these package areas and responsibility for directing the workload of a team of Design Engineers to support this. Packages areas included wheels, chassis, suspension, brakes and ergonomics.Working with product planning, stylists and procurement determined concept viability of the Rocket 3 Touring model. The culmination of this work was a fully developed and Engineered concept motorcycle that was taken into volume production.Whilst working on the Sprint ST model responsible for developing a company first ABS system in conjunction with a Japanese brake manufacturer. Developing test procedures and setting system acceptance metrics whilst working with test riders to develop performance and Design Engineers to deliver packaging requirements.Worked as a Test Engineer on the Triumph Thunderbird model. Overall responsibility to deliver suitable chassis handling dynamics working with test riders, tyre, suspension and brake suppliers. Show less
